# Android App Development: Your Gateway to the Mobile Future The mobile revolution shows no signs of slowing down. With billions of smartphones in pockets worldwide, the demand for innovative and user-friendly apps is ever-growing. If you've ever dreamt of shaping the mobile landscape, then Android app development might be the perfect path for you. ## Why Android? Here's Your Edge Massive User Base: Android boasts a staggering user base, making it an ideal platform to reach a global audience with your app. Open-Source Advantage: The open-source nature of Android development allows for greater flexibility and customization compared to some other platforms. Thriving Developer Community: Never get stuck! The vast Android developer community offers a wealth of resources, tutorials, and forums to help you on your journey. From Concept to Creation: The App Development Pipeline Ideation & Planning: Every great app starts with a spark of an idea. Identify a problem you can solve or a niche you can cater to. Plan your app's functionalities and user experience. Learning the Lingo: Master the language of Android development. Kotlin, known for its readability and features, is the preferred choice for building modern Android apps. Embrace the Tools: Android Studio is your one-stop shop for developing, testing, and debugging your app. Leverage additional tools and libraries to streamline the process. Building Blocks of Your App: Understand core concepts like Activities (screens), Layouts (visual design), and Fragments (reusable UI components). These are the building blocks that bring your app to life. Testing & Refinement: Rigorous testing is crucial. Iron out any bugs and ensure your app functions flawlessly across different devices. Launch & Beyond! Once you're confident, publish your app on the Google Play Store. The journey doesn't end there – gather user feedback and constantly iterate to keep your app at the forefront. ## Beyond the Basics: Supercharge Your App Material Design: Embrace Google's Material Design principles for a visually appealing and intuitive user experience. Integrations: Tap into powerful APIs and services like Google Maps, payment gateways, and social media logins to enhance your app's functionality. Performance Optimization: Ensure your app runs smoothly and efficiently across a wide range of devices. Analytics & User Engagement: Track user behavior and gather valuable insights to refine your app and keep users engaged. ## Conclusion The world of **[Android app development](https://www.apporio.com/services/android-app-development)** is an exciting and ever-evolving landscape. With dedication, the right tools, and a passion for creating something new, you can turn your app idea into a reality. So, are you ready to join the ranks of successful Android app developers? Download Android Studio, start learning, and get ready to make your mark on the mobile world!